The Dodge County Sheriff’s Department says a 911 call was made around 5 p.m. from the residence near  250th Ave and 723rd St. in rural Hayfield. Firefighters from Hayfield and Kasson fought the blaze, which was mostly on the exterior of the home.

The department says an outdoor bush caught fire and the flames spread to a corner of the house and then to the home’s gas meter. There was some damage to the interior of the house, but most was confined to the outdoor siding of the residence.

The department says  three people were transported to St. Mary’s for treatment of minor smoke inhalation.

 No damage estimate was made.
